Output dbb76e403bc04a15b26c3b41cff5dca4ecd39be450d6902b20b3d6e7f91da9fc:1

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07b27e54d8eab51a21a8c410fbbfe0a41156eccb OP_EQUALVERIFY OP_CHECKSIG
address
1hhZHfjErovmhRBUnme4FX6VKiguXrK2a
transaction
dbb76e403bc04a15b26c3b41cff5dca4ecd39be450d6902b20b3d6e7f91da9fc
confirmations
298232
spent
true